Relaxing 7-Day Itinerary for Uttar Pradesh in June 2023

  1. Day 1: Lucknow
    30 minutes (9.5 km) from Chaudhary Charan Singh International Airport

    Start your day with a peaceful visit to Bara Imambara, a beautiful mosque built in the 18th century. In the afternoon, take a stroll through the lush greenery of Ambedkar Memorial Park. In the evening, enjoy a traditional Lucknowi dinner at Idris ki Biryani.

  2. Day 2: Varanasi
    6 hours (320 km) from Lucknow

    Begin your day with a sunrise boat ride on the Ganges river, followed by a visit to the Kashi Vishwanath Temple, one of the most famous Hindu temples in India. Spend your afternoon exploring the narrow alleys of the old city and shopping for souvenirs. In the evening, attend the mesmerizing Ganga Aarti ceremony at Dashashwamedh Ghat.

  3. Day 3: Allahabad
    3 hours (130 km) from Varanasi

    Start your day with a visit to the Allahabad Fort, a vast military fortification that dates back to the 16th century. In the afternoon, visit the Anand Bhavan Museum, the former residence of the Nehru-Gandhi family. In the evening, take a peaceful walk along the banks of the Triveni Sangam, the confluence of the Ganges, Yamuna, and Saraswati rivers.

  4. Day 4: Agra
    3 hours 30 minutes (230 km) from Allahabad

    Start your day with a visit to the stunning Taj Mahal, one of the Seven Wonders of the World. In the afternoon, explore the Agra Fort, a 16th-century Mughal monument. In the evening, enjoy a Mughlai dinner at the famous restaurant Pinch of Spice.

  5. Day 5: Mathura
    1 hour 30 minutes (60 km) from Agra

    Start your day with a visit to the Shri Krishna Janmabhoomi temple, the birthplace of Lord Krishna. In the afternoon, explore the historic town of Vrindavan, home to several ancient temples and ashrams. In the evening, attend the spectacular evening aarti at the Banke Bihari Temple.

  6. Day 6: Ayodhya
    4 hours 30 minutes (200 km) from Mathura

    Start your day with a visit to the Ram Janmabhoomi Temple, the birthplace of Lord Rama. In the afternoon, visit the Hanuman Garhi Temple, a beautiful temple dedicated to Lord Hanuman. In the evening, take a peaceful walk along the banks of the Sarayu river.

  7. Day 7: Sarnath
    10 hours (700 km) from Ayodhya

    Start your day with a visit to the Dhamek Stupa, a massive Buddhist stupa built in the 5th century. In the afternoon, explore the Sarnath Archaeological Museum, which houses a collection of ancient artifacts and sculptures. In the evening, attend the evening aarti at the Mulagandha Kuti Vihar Temple.
